June 3, Pozirk. “We have taken appropriate retaliatory measures against the most zealous EU members,” Deputy Foreign Minister Ihar Nazaruk told state media in connection with the increase in tariffs on some agricultural imports from Russia and Belarus to the European Union, which will take effect on July 1.
According to Nazaruk, these measures “mirror, according to economists’ calculations, the effect that was sought with regard to Belarus.”
“I think our partners in the EU will not like our retaliatory measures,” he said.
Nazaruk made the remarks ahead of the plenary session Food Security of the Eurasian Economic Union at the Belagro exhibition on June 3 in the Smalavičy district, Minsk region.
